https://gcc.gnu.org/bugzilla/show_bug.cgi?id=94273
--- Comment #11 from CVS Commits <cvs-commit at gcc dot gnu.org> --- The master branch has been updated by Richard Biener <rgue...@gcc.gnu.org>: https://gcc.gnu.org/g:45cfaf9903d3f5aa916d330f2013eb7d820a7137 commit r10-7418-g45cfaf9903d3f5aa916d330f2013eb7d820a7137 Author: Richard Biener <rguent...@suse.de> Date: Fri Mar 27 13:57:42 2020 +0100 debug/94273 - avoid creating type DIEs for DINFO_LEVEL_TERSE This avoids completing types for DINFO_LEVEL_TERSE by using the should_emit_struct_debug machinery. 2020-03-27 Richard Biener <rguent...@suse.de> PR debug/94273 * dwarf2out.c (should_emit_struct_debug): Return false for DINFO_LEVEL_TERSE. * g++.dg/debug/pr94273.C: New testcase.